  1. Two-Wheel Alignment:
    Two-wheel alignment focuses on adjusting the front wheels of a vehicle. This service is particularly useful for vehicles that have a solid rear axle. The process involves setting the angles of the front wheels to ensure they are parallel and pointed straight ahead. According to automotive experts, two-wheel alignments are often recommended for vehicles that only require minor adjustments. This service can enhance steering accuracy and tire longevity.

  2. Four-Wheel Alignment:
    Four-wheel alignment adjusts all four wheels and is essential for vehicles with independent suspension systems. This comprehensive service ensures that all wheels are set to the manufacturer’s specifications. The Automotive Service Association states that improper alignment can lead to uneven tire wear, which may decrease the lifespan of the tires. A four-wheel alignment is advisable for vehicles that experience frequent adjustments or that show signs of uneven tire wear.

  3. Front-End Alignment:
    Front-end alignment involves adjusting only the front wheels with a focus on the suspension components that affect steering. This service is suitable for vehicles that predominantly steer from the front. Mechanics indicate that a front-end alignment can improve maneuverability and driving comfort, especially in larger vehicles.

  4. Thrust Angle Alignment:
    Thrust angle alignment is used to ensure that the rear wheels are aligned with the front wheels. This service is vital for vehicles that experience frequent misalignment, often due to collisions or potholes. The importance of thrust angle alignment lies in its impact on vehicle stability and accurate steering; it also addresses issues of off-center steering. Experts agree that this service can significantly improve handling and safety.

How Do Technicians at Andy’s Tires Conduct Wheel Alignments?

Technicians at Andy’s Tires conduct wheel alignments using specialized equipment to ensure that the car’s wheels are set to the manufacturer’s specifications for optimal vehicle handling and tire longevity. The process can be broken down into several key steps:

  1. Initial Inspection: Technicians begin with a thorough inspection of the vehicle. They check the tires for wear patterns, assess suspension components, and ensure nothing is obstructing the alignment process. According to the Automotive Research Center, improper tire wear can indicate alignment issues (Smith, 2022).

  2. Measurement Setup: Next, the technician positions the vehicle on a leveling alignment rack. They use computerized alignment machines equipped with sensors that measure wheel angles. This setup helps technicians gather precise data about the vehicle’s current alignment status.

  3. Adjustments: Based on the measurements, technicians make necessary adjustments to the camber, caster, and toe angles.
    – Camber refers to the tilt of the wheels inward or outward when viewed from the front.
    – Caster is the angle of the steering pivot when viewed from the side.
    – Toe is the alignment of the wheels relative to each other, viewed from above.

  4. Final Inspection: After making the adjustments, technicians recheck the wheel angles to confirm they meet the manufacturer’s specifications. This step ensures proper alignment and helps prevent future tire wear.

  5. Test Drive: Finally, technicians may take the vehicle for a short test drive. This test allows them to evaluate steering responsiveness and overall handling. Any necessary tweaks can be made based on the driving experience.

By following these steps, technicians at Andy’s Tires ensure that vehicles benefit from proper wheel alignment, improving safety, driving comfort, and tire lifespan.
